The Cambridge Encyclopedia of Australia Summary

The Cambridge Encyclopedia of Australia by Susan Bambrick (La Trobe University, Victoria)

The essential single-volume reference source describes all aspects of Australia. With contributions from over ninety experts, it provides comprehensive coverage of life in twentieth-century Australia alongside a host of insights into culture, the Aboriginal heritage, the natural world, and the continent's colourful past. Eight major sections examine all the key aspects of the continent, past and present: the physical continent, the Aboriginal heritage, history since European contact, government, economy, society, science and technology, and culture and the arts.

Table of Contents

1. The physical continent; 2. The aboriginal heritage; 3. History since European contact; 4. Government; 5. The economy; 6. Society; 7. Science and technology; 8. Culture and the arts.
